4. Jurisdictions and Regulations

The legality of streaming casino games on Twitch varies depending on the jurisdiction. In some countries, such as the United States, online gambling is legal in certain states, while in others, it is strictly prohibited. Similarly, the laws regarding the streaming of casino games on Twitch also differ from one country to another.

For example, in the United States, the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) of 2006 makes it illegal to engage in online gambling transactions. However, the act does not explicitly prohibit the streaming of casino games. This has led to a gray area in terms of legal implications for Twitch streamers.
